The Hypertension Score in 59731, Garrison, Montana is 65 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
77.50 percent of the population in 59731 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 60.00 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 25.00 percent of the residents in 59731 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.79 members with about 2.46 cars available per household.
An estimate of 99.30 percent of the residents in 59731 has some form of health insurance. 69.93 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 47.55 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 59731 would have to travel an average of 10.99 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Deer Lodge Medical Center - Cah .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 59731, Garrison, Montana.

As of , an estimate of 143 residents live in 59731 with a median age of 40.1 years. 23.08 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 26.57 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 38.10 percent of the residents in 59731 is currently married, and 32.54 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 59731 is $3,489.58.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 59731 is approximately $1,048. The median household spends about 30.03 percent of their income on housing.
